#dd69f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d69f1 is composed of 86.7% red, 41.2%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.3% cyan, 56.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 291.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 67.8%. #dd69f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#bb00e3.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#dd69f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d69f1 has RGB values of R:221, G:105,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14510577.

Shades and Tints of #dd69f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010b is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d69f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0a8b2 is the less saturated color, while #e65cfe is the most saturated one.
